-PSR Log
-=======
-
-This repository holds all interfaces/classes/traits related to
-[PSR-3](https://github.com/php-fig/fig-standards/blob/master/accepted/PSR-3-logger-interface.md).
-
-Note that this is not a logger of its own. It is merely an interface that
-describes a logger. See the specification for more details.
-
-Installation
-------------
-
-```bash
-composer require psr/log
-```
-
-Usage
------
-
-If you need a logger, you can use the interface like this:
-
-```php
-<?php
-
-use Psr\Log\LoggerInterface;
-
-class Foo
-{
- private $logger;
-
- public function __construct(LoggerInterface $logger = null)
- {
- $this->logger = $logger;
- }
-
- public function doSomething()
- {
- if ($this->logger) {
- $this->logger->info('Doing work');
- }
-
- try {
- $this->doSomethingElse();
- } catch (Exception $exception) {
- $this->logger->error('Oh no!', array('exception' => $exception));
- }
-
- // do something useful
- }
-}
-```
-
-You can then pick one of the implementations of the interface to get a logger.
-
-If you want to implement the interface, you can require this package and
-implement `Psr\Log\LoggerInterface` in your code. Please read the
-[specification text](https://github.com/php-fig/fig-standards/blob/master/accepted/PSR-3-logger-interface.md)
-for details.

-<?php
-
-namespace Psr\Log;
-
-/**
- * Describes a logger instance.
- *
- * The message MUST be a string or object implementing __toString().
- *
- * The message MAY contain placeholders in the form: {foo} where foo
- * will be replaced by the context data in key "foo".
- *
- * The context array can contain arbitrary data. The only assumption that
- * can be made by implementors is that if an Exception instance is given
- * to produce a stack trace, it MUST be in a key named "exception".
- *
- * See https://github.com/php-fig/fig-standards/blob/master/accepted/PSR-3-logger-interface.md
- * for the full interface specification.
- */
-interface LoggerInterface
-{
- /**
- * System is unusable.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function emergency(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Action must be taken immediately.
- *
- * Example: Entire website down, database unavailable, etc. This should
- * trigger the SMS alerts and wake you up.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function alert(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Critical conditions.
- *
- * Example: Application component unavailable, unexpected exception.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function critical(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Runtime errors that do not require immediate action but should typically
- * be logged and monitored.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function error(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Exceptional occurrences that are not errors.
- *
- * Example: Use of deprecated APIs, poor use of an API, undesirable things
- * that are not necessarily wrong.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function warning(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Normal but significant events.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function notice(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Interesting events.
- *
- * Example: User logs in, SQL logs.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function info(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Detailed debug information.
- *
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- */
- public function debug(string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-
- /**
- * Logs with an arbitrary level.
- *
- * @param mixed $level
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param mixed[] $context
- *
- * @return void
- *
- * @throws \Psr\Log\InvalidArgumentException
- */
- public function log($level, string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void;
-}

-<?php
-
-namespace Psr\Log;
-
-/**
- * This Logger can be used to avoid conditional log calls.
- *
- * Logging should always be optional, and if no logger is provided to your
- * library creating a NullLogger instance to have something to throw logs at
- * is a good way to avoid littering your code with `if ($this->logger) { }`
- * blocks.
- */
-class NullLogger extends AbstractLogger
-{
- /**
- * Logs with an arbitrary level.
- *
- * @param mixed $level
- * @param string|\Stringable $message
- * @param array $context
- *
- * @return void
- *
- * @throws \Psr\Log\InvalidArgumentException
- */
- public function log($level, string|\Stringable $message, array $context = []): void
- {
- // noop
- }
-}
